問題タブ [ahoy]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ruby-on-rails - アホイはイベントや訪問を記録していません
Railsアプリケーションでユーザー分析を行うためにAhoyをインストールしました。Rails 4.1.10 を実行し、Postgres 9.3.10 を使用しています
gemfile に gem を追加しました。
そして、私は実行しました:
ドキュメントに従って。
//=require ahoy
また、application.js アセット ファイルの jquery の後に追加しました。
訪問とイベントが自動的に追跡されるかどうかわからなかったので、いくつかのページに移動して DB を手動で確認しましたが、訪問または ahoy_events テーブルにエントリがありません。そこで、これを手動でランディング ページ インデックス コントローラー アクションにコーディングしました。
そして、この行は次のエラーを引き起こします:
(ここに完全にリストされています: https://gist.github.com/renegadeandy/835a7fb0db2bb9d8ea95 )
訪問やイベントのログを記録するのを手伝ってくれる人はいますか? 理想的には、押す必要があるゴールデンスイッチがある場合は、自動的にすべてを追跡する必要があります:)
ruby-on-rails - Ahoy_email gem : clicked_at、opened_at が更新されない?
ahoy_email ruby gem を使用して、送信したメールを追跡しています。開いてクリックしたときの時間を教えてくれるはずです。しかし、時間を与えるのは適切に機能していません。私が欠けているもの。
注:ローカルホストでプロジェクトを実行します
ahoy - Ahoy は DB にイベントを保存していませんが、ログに POST リクエストがあります
Ahoy が情報をデータベースに登録する際に問題が発生していますが、ログには投稿要求が表示されています。
これがデータベースに保存されない理由はありますか?
ありがとう!
ruby-on-rails - Rails モデルでの Ahoy カスタム イベントの追跡
ahoy でカスタム イベント トラッキングを使用する方法がわかりません。ドキュメントに従って、
私のモデルの1つで、しかし私は得る
ahoy イベントを追跡できる唯一の場所はコントローラーですか?